Senior Specialist, Plan Design
Senior Specialist supporting retirement plan design, document drafting, and compliance for defined contribution plans. Requires 5+ years of qualified plan experience and deep ERISA/regulatory knowledge.
Responsibilities
- Plan Design Consultation: Collaborate with Plan Sponsors to create optimal defined contribution plan designs, addressing queries, and ensuring a clear understanding of chosen plan specifications for both new sponsors setting up their plan and existing sponsors with plan amendments.
- Plan Document Review: Support sales in conversion contract considerations by performing a plan spec review against supported and outsourced design models; capture plan design conversations and decisions from presale, sale, and onboarding processes to create new plan documents.
- Regulatory Interpretation & Compliance Expertise: Independently interpret ERISA and other applicable laws, regulations, and guidance to create, amend, and restate retirement plan documents that are legally compliant and operationally sound.
- Plan Document Drafting & Maintenance: Prepare plan documents, including discretionary and interim amendments, restatements, participant notices, and related disclosures, ensuring consistency with plan design decisions and platform capabilities.
- Independent Judgment & Analysis: Exercise discretion in evaluating plan design requests, assessing legal and operational risk, and determining appropriate document structures with minimal supervision.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ration: Work closely with Onboarding, Retirement Plan Administration, Client Success, and Employer Services teams to ensure plan documents support seamless implementation and ongoing administration.
- Process & Documentation Improvement: Support and contribute to process reviews, research, and documentation related to plan document operations, corrections, and audit support.
- Project Management: Design and manage workflows for novel and recurring large-scale document projects, ensuring timely, accurate, and scalable execution.
- Product & Automation Support: Partner with Product teams to improve document automation, technology-supported drafting processes, and overall plan document management capabilities.
Requirements
- Subject Matter Expertise - Understanding of Employee Retirement Income Security Act (ERISA), Department of Labor (DOL), Internal Revenue Service (IRS) regulations
- At least 5 years of experience in qualified/non-qualified plans including sales support, design consultation, document drafting, and non-discrimination testing
- Keen attention to detail, deadlines, and customer service needs along with strong communication skills
- Collaborative approach with internal stakeholders and with clients to clearly communicate the process, timing, and plan design considerations of new, amended and restated plans
- Strong commitment to proactively managing workload
- Proficiency with Excel and Microsoft Office suite; Google Workspace; cloud-based client portals and internal network drives
